summaryrefslogtreecommitdiff
path: root/src/input_common (follow)
Commit message (Collapse)AuthorAgeFilesLines
* input_common: Fix virtual amiibosGravatar bunnei2023-06-031-4/+4
|
* android: Various fixes for CI.Gravatar bunnei2023-06-031-10/+10
|
* android: Implement amiibo reading from nfc tagGravatar Narr the Reg2023-06-032-4/+24
|
* android: Add motion sensorGravatar Narr the Reg2023-06-032-1/+27
|
* input_common: rename PAGE_SIZE to avoid conflictGravatar 121011112023-05-301-3/+3
| | | | See also: https://github.com/yuzu-emu/yuzu/issues/8779
* Merge pull request #10396 from german77/amiibo_writeGravatar bunnei2023-05-256-62/+376
|\ | | | | input_common: Implement amiibo writing
| * input_common: Implement amiibo writtingGravatar Narr the Reg2023-05-216-62/+376
| |
* | input_common: Map motion with relative values not absolute onesGravatar german772023-05-191-4/+7
|/
* input_common: Fix pro controller amiibo supportGravatar Narr the Reg2023-05-166-103/+70
|
* input_common: Make amiibo scanning less demandingGravatar german772023-05-143-4/+13
|
* Merge pull request #10119 from marius851000/improved_non_hd_feebackGravatar Narr the Reg2023-05-091-6/+29
|\ | | | | Attempt at improving HD Rumble emulation
| * Improve emulation of HD RumbleGravatar marius david2023-05-051-6/+29
| |
* | input_common: Fix nfc detection for joyconsGravatar german772023-05-094-19/+21
| |
* | core: hid: Update motion on a better placeGravatar german772023-05-071-1/+1
| |
* | Merge pull request #10180 from german77/debugGravatar bunnei2023-05-061-2/+0
|\ \ | | | | | | input_common: Revert debugging changes
| * | input_common: Revert debugging changesGravatar german772023-05-061-2/+0
| | |
* | | Merge pull request #10174 from german77/motriodGravatar bunnei2023-05-061-0/+3
|\ \ \ | |/ / |/| | input_common: Add experimental motion to button
| * | input_common: Add experimental motion to buttonGravatar german772023-05-051-0/+3
| |/
* / input_common: Add property to invert an axis buttonGravatar Narr the Reg2023-05-052-0/+3
|/
* input_common: minor fix to mouse movementGravatar Valeri2023-04-141-1/+1
|
* input_common: sdl: Only send last vibration commandGravatar german772023-03-121-1/+16
|
* general: fix spelling mistakesGravatar Liam2023-03-1211-16/+16
|
* Merge pull request #9906 from german77/metroid2Gravatar bunnei2023-03-082-9/+19
|\ | | | | input_common: Increase mouse sensitivity range
| * input_common: Increase mouse sensitivity rangeGravatar german772023-03-072-9/+19
| |
* | input_common: Minor typo issues (#9922)Gravatar Narr the Reg2023-03-087-47/+47
| |
* | input_common: joycon: Add stick input from passive reportsGravatar german772023-03-053-32/+84
|/
* cmake: use correct boost imported targetsGravatar Alexandre Bouvier2023-02-281-1/+1
|
* input_common: Implement dedicated motion from mouseGravatar Narr the Reg2023-02-213-24/+85
|
* input_common: Split mouse input into individual devicesGravatar Narr the Reg2023-02-163-24/+85
|
* remove static from pointer sized or smaller types for aesthetics, change ↵Gravatar arades792023-02-1411-35/+35
| | | | | | constexpr static to static constexpr for consistency Signed-off-by: arades79 <scravers@protonmail.com>
* add static lifetime to constexpr values to force compile time evaluation ↵Gravatar arades792023-02-1411-35/+35
| | | | | | where possible Signed-off-by: arades79 <scravers@protonmail.com>
* input_common: Reintroduce custom pro controller supportGravatar Narr the Reg2023-02-094-4/+67
|
* input_common: Simplify stick from buttonGravatar Narr the Reg2023-02-021-32/+13
|
* Merge pull request #9696 from german77/please_forgive_me_for_this_sinGravatar bunnei2023-02-011-12/+18
|\ | | | | input_common: Implement turbo buttons
| * input_common: Implement turbo buttonsGravatar german772023-02-011-12/+18
| |
* | input_common: joycon: Remove Magic numbers from common protocolGravatar Narr the Reg2023-01-299-154/+221
| |
* | input_common: joycon: Fill missing enum dataGravatar Narr the Reg2023-01-296-41/+53
|/
* Move to Clang Format 15Gravatar Levi Behunin2023-01-291-2/+2
| | | | | | Depends on https://github.com/yuzu-emu/build-environments/pull/69 clang-15 primary run
* Merge pull request #9689 from german77/joycon-calibrationGravatar bunnei2023-01-296-114/+215
|\ | | | | input_common: joycon: Remove magic numbers from calibration protocol
| * input_common: joycon: Replace ReadSPI vector with spanGravatar Narr the Reg2023-01-273-20/+26
| |
| * input_common: joycon: Remove magic numbers from calibration protocolGravatar Narr the Reg2023-01-276-107/+202
| |
* | Merge pull request #9677 from Morph1984/sleep-oneGravatar bunnei2023-01-272-5/+6
|\ \ | |/ |/| polyfill_thread: Implement StoppableTimedWait
| * input_common: Make use of StoppableTimedWaitGravatar Morph2023-01-252-5/+6
| |
* | Merge pull request #9683 from german77/high_power_joyconGravatar bunnei2023-01-264-0/+21
|\ \ | | | | | | input_common: Implement SetLowPowerMode and TriggersElapsed
| * | input_common: Implement SetLowPowerMode and TriggersElapsed for the joycon ↵Gravatar Narr the Reg2023-01-264-0/+21
| | | | | | | | | | | | driver
* | | Merge pull request #9676 from german77/revert-stick-rangeGravatar liamwhite2023-01-251-2/+7
|\| | | |/ |/| Revert #9617 and fix it on input_common
| * Revert 9617 and fix it on input_commonGravatar Narr the Reg2023-01-251-2/+7
| |
* | input_common: add missing header for libc++ after 340f15d1fa79Gravatar Jan Beich2023-01-251-0/+1
|/ | | | | | | | | | | | | | | src/input_common/drivers/joycon.cpp:187:26: error: no member named 'find_if' in namespace 'std::ranges' std::ranges::find_if(left_joycons, [](auto& device) { return !device->IsConnected(); }); ~~~~~~~~~~~~~^ src/input_common/drivers/joycon.cpp:193:54: error: no member named 'find_if' in namespace 'std::ranges' const auto unconnected_device = std::ranges::find_if( ~~~~~~~~~~~~~^ src/input_common/drivers/joycon.cpp:393:51: error: no member named 'find_if' in namespace 'std::ranges' const auto matching_device = std::ranges::find_if( ~~~~~~~~~~~~~^ src/input_common/drivers/joycon.cpp:402:51: error: no member named 'find_if' in namespace 'std::ranges' const auto matching_device = std::ranges::find_if( ~~~~~~~~~~~~~^
* Merge pull request #9492 from german77/joycon_releaseGravatar liamwhite2023-01-2435-33/+5013
|\ | | | | Input_common: Implement custom joycon driver v2
| * input_common: Fix joycon mappingsGravatar german772023-01-202-57/+53
| |